Does anyone know the story behind the word "Redneck"? What is it about red necks that gives this phrase it's meaning? What is the origin of this now-common phrase?

Actually, I do know. They're all farm workers, who spend most of their time in the fields, bending over, and so were extremely prone to getting sunburn, on their necks in particular.

It's not just farmers; rednecks are usually blue-collar folks who work outside (road crews, construction workers, etc.) and are generally considered lacking in social graces, education and sophistication.
